But, by following the steps as shown at
http://www.adobe.com/cfusion/knowledgebase/index.cfm?id=tn_14786 I was
able
to use a shared font successfully in Flash 8. It sounds as if you may be
taking some unnecessary steps: for example, you shouldn't need to include
any text fields in your sharedfonts.fla. Also, make sure that you follow
the method of "Open As Library" as described in the TechNote. (In Flash
8,
this is File > Import > Open External Library). Setting the library font
to
a different font may in fact be causing a problem - I would suggest
instead
testing with wingdings or some other crazy font so you can know for sure
it's working.
